A staff of researchers at Q-CTRL, a quantum infrastructure software-maker based mostly in Sydney, Australia, has introduced the profitable demonstration of its newly developed quantum navigation system referred to as “Ironstone Opal.”

The group has written a paper describing how their system works and the way nicely it examined towards presently obtainable backup GPS techniques and has posted it on the arXiv preprint server.

With the arrival and subsequent reliance on GPS by personal and navy autos and plane for navigation, governments have come to grasp how susceptible such techniques will be. Outages can result in drivers being stranded, pilots scrambling to make use of outdated techniques and difficulties deploying navy property. Due to that, scientists world wide have been in search of affordable backup techniques, and even potential options to GPS.

On this new effort, the staff at Q-CTRL has developed such a backup system and is claiming that it’s 50 occasions extra correct than every other backup GPS presently obtainable underneath some eventualities.






The brand new system, Ironstone Opal, makes use of quantum sensors which are so delicate they can be utilized to exactly self-locate an object utilizing the Earth’s magnetic discipline. The staff at Q-CTRL famous that the magnetic discipline varies relying on location relative to the Earth. To reap the benefits of that, they constructed sensors that may exactly learn the sphere after which use AI-based software program to provide X and Y geographic coordinates in the identical style as GPS.

The researchers be aware that their system is passive, which suggests it doesn’t emit indicators that could possibly be “heard” by different gadgets and can’t be jammed. In addition they be aware that their software program system can filter out noise generated by autos or planes carrying the sensors. They level out that the system is sufficiently small to be put in in any automobile, truck, or different land car, in addition to in drones and different plane.

Testing of the system on the bottom, the researchers declare, confirmed it to be 50 occasions as correct as every other GPS backup system. Within the air, it was discovered to be 11 occasions extra correct than different backup techniques.
